Area description
Chamberí. This centric neighbourhood preserves beautiful buildings from last century, most of which have been restored. As you go on to the José Abascal Street, the buildings are more modern and the houses more expensive. The bustle of the neighbourhood is concentrated along the Fuencarral and Luchana Street, up to the Plaza de Olavide. There is a large amount of cinemas in this stretch, which come one after the other, together with cake shops, cafés and clothes shops. On the adjacent streets to Fuencarral and on other further streets, such as Covarrubias, there are many tapas bars, restaurants and pubs/bars. The Santa Engracia Street concentrates the activity of banks, supermarkets and shops such as hardware stores, besides several Metro stations. Due to its closeness to the Salamanca district, Chamberi is appreciated by students from the Instituto de Empresa.
